About D. E. Ward

D. E. Ward is a scholar working on Cardiology and Cardiovascular Medicine, Surgery, Pharmacology, Organizational Behavior and Human Resource Management and Radiology, Nuclear Medicine and Imaging, having authored 47 papers that have together received 811 indexed citations. Recurring topics across this work include Cardiac Arrhythmias and Treatments (31 papers), Cardiac electrophysiology and arrhythmias (22 papers), Cardiac pacing and defibrillation studies (17 papers), Atrial Fibrillation Management and Outcomes (11 papers), Cardiovascular Syncope and Autonomic Disorders (5 papers), Cardiovascular Effects of Exercise (4 papers), ECG Monitoring and Analysis (2 papers) and Cardiac Imaging and Diagnostics (2 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(730 citations), Surgery (143 citations), Radiology, Nuclear Medicine and Imaging (51 citations), Emergency Medicine (21 citations) and Orthopedics and Sports Medicine (8 citations). D. E. Ward has collaborated with scholars based in United Kingdom, India and Ireland. Frequent co-authors include A. John Camm, Davendra Mehta, A. W. Nathan, T Cripps, William J. McKenna, Ed Bennett, R A Spurrell, A. John Camm, Michael J. Davies and Edward Rowland. Their work appears in journals such as Heart, Clinical Cardiology, European Heart Journal, Pacing and Clinical Electrophysiology and The Lancet.
